Heritage party calls on RA PM to initiate referendum on Armenian-Turkish protocols

PanARMENIAN.Net - Heritage opposition party sent a letter to Armenian Prime Minister Tigran Sargsyan calling on him to initiate a referendum on Armenian-Turkish protocols.



"We call for a referendum before final signature and ratification of the document. The nation should pass its vote of confidence or no confidence in the President, who is responsible for the country's foreign policy," the party said in the letter, which implies receipt of a written response during 10 days.
